צְפוֹנִי

tse.pho.niNounH6831

Zephonite

From: patronymically from H6827 (צְפוֹן);

Short Definition

a Tsephonite, or (collectively) descendants of Tsephon

Full Lexicon Entry

Someone descended from Zephon who was a man of the tribe of Gad living at the time of Egypt and Wilderness, first mentioned at ; son of: Gad (H1410); brother of: Haggi (H2291), Shuni (H7764), Ezbon (H0675), Eri (H6179), Arod (H0720) and Areli (H0692); also called Zephon at ; Group of tsiph.yon (*צִפְיוֹן *"Ziphion" H6837) § Zephonites, of Zephon "treasure" descendants of Zephon, the son of Gad
